Frequently Asked Questions

1. Is the assessed value a reliable indicator of the likely selling price?
An assessed value is used for calculating property taxes and is based on mass appraisal methods. While it indicates the municipality’s view of the property’s worth relative to its neighbours, the actual selling price is determined by the current market, condition of the home, and buyer demand. Its above-average assessment for the area signals perceived value, but may not directly translate to sale price.

2. How does the larger lot size impact costs and possibilities?
A larger lot means more outdoor maintenance but also greater privacy and potential. It could allow for additions like a shed, deck, or garage, subject to local zoning bylaws. Property taxes may also be influenced by lot size. It’s a long-term asset that offers flexibility that smaller lots do not.

3. What does the 1971 build date mean for maintenance?
A home from this era may have original or aging components like windows, roofing, or major systems (heating, electrical) that could need attention or updating. A thorough home inspection is essential to identify any immediate needs and help plan for future upgrades, which can be a way to add value.
